Blocks A and B are connected by a cable that passes over support C. Friction between the blocks and the inclined surfaces can be neglected. Knowing that motion of block B up the incline is impending when 16 WB = lb, determine

(a) The coefficient of static friction between the rope and the support,

(b) The largest value of WB for which equilibrium is maintained.
